89 38. Deidre Scherer WWW.DSCHERER.COM VERMONT, USA “ Clasped Hands is a collaborative work with Jackie Abrams. It is a delight and great adventure to think and brew on three-dimensional projects with her. I pull frommy extensive history of original images in thread-on-fabric, reconfiguring and reassociating them through Photoshop before printing them on cotton paper in our codesigned templates. Jackie deconstructs the printed images and then reconnects them while she weaves; in this case, with copper wire.” Joining with Jackie in the effort to create three- dimensional vessels from my two-dimensional, layered f igurative work presented joy—and anticipation for the next project, the new idea that will follow. I wanted our work to communicate with our audience, to speak of connection and the discovery of friendship. All the clasped hands inherently say this.
